Kariba Lake, witness of the South-African drought

The Aviso website supported by the CNES chose in January to report on the evolution of Lake Kariba, on the border of Zambia and Zimbabwe, revealing the drought that southern Africa is currently experiencing.

An evolution made visible by the Theia Hydroweb product which documents the evolution of this great lake of the Zambezi basin since 1992.
